Abstract

This paper introduced the target-driven virtual humans model having autonomous behaviors ability, and realized it by combining fluent calculus with virtual humans in virtual reality, based on the research on the theory of fluent calculus and its implementation language FLUX. In addition, designed the action detection model to judge whether the next action could be performed according to its detecting results by using action queue to store the sequences of actions, making virtual human can make effective plans in dynamic changed virtual environment. By implementing this model, intelligent virtual humans can be constructed quickly which could reason about action automatically and real-time using the limited information acquired from sensor in an incomplete, dynamic environment by themselves for any given goals. Finally, action planning system for intelligent virtual human of office scenario is achieved.
